A high-speed algorithm for computation of fractional differentiation and fractional integration
Masataka Fukunaga1, Nobuyuki Shimizu
1College of Engineering, Nihon University, 1-2-35-405, Katahira, Aoba-ku, Sendai 980-0812, Japan. fukunaga@apple.ifnet.or.jp
Abstract:
A high-speed algorithm for computing fractional differentiations and fractional integrations in fractional differential equations is proposed. In this algorithm, the stored data are not the function to be differentiated or integrated but the weighted integrals of the function. The intervals of integration for the memory can be increased without loss of accuracy as the computing time-step n increases. The computing cost varies as n log n, as opposed to n(2) of standard algorithms.
